    (07-14-2014, 05:29 AM)reeay Wrote: I don't agree... Emotions are hormonal signals that occurs in the body complex/brain. They can cross over if they are interpreted via mind. Ra mentions in 42.11 they are merely signposts like we call emotions 'markers' in psychology - they just point to something that we're trying to make more conscious.

    MBTI distinguishes feelings and intuition By the way, Jung saw them as separate constructs.

    I don't mean to give the impression that emotions do not have a biological and chemical reflection in the body. I just don't think that is where they begin.

    Imagine for a moment that you are discarnate, a spirit with no chemical vehicle. Would you then be an emotionless robot? I would argue the physical apparatus only reflects the inpouring emotions which begin in the mind complex.

    I'm familiar with the distinction Jung saw between them, I just don't see a significant distinction between them myself, in my own personal experience. They both arise in response to focus, in my experience.
